Dynamics of Concentrated Polymer Solutions Revisited: Isomonomeric Friction Adjustment and Its Consequences was written by Yan, Zhi-Chao;Zhang, Bao-Qing;Liu, Chen-Yang. And the article was included in Macromolecules (Washington, DC, United States) in 2014.HPLC of Formula: 5444-75-7 The following contents are mentioned in the article:

In concentrated polymer solutions, the concentration (ϕ) dependence of the terminal relaxation time τd reflects ϕ-dependent changes of several factors, the monomeric friction ζ0(ϕ), the entanglement length, a(ϕ), and the correlation length, ξ(ϕ). Usually, the effect of the latter two factors on τd can be cast in a simple power law, τd ∼ ϕv. This power law form is to be examined for τd after correction of the changes of ζ0 with ϕ, but this iso-ζ0 correction is an unsettled problem. The correction based on the concept of “iso-free-volume” has been attempted in literatures. This study focused on four groups of solutions with different local frictional environments to examine universal validity of this correction. The isothermal data of τd were rheol. measured, and then corrected to the iso-frictional (iso-ζ0) state. After this correction, τd of most solutions in small mol. solvents showed the power law behavior τd ∼ ϕv with exponent of v = 2.0 ± 0.2, irresp. of the solvent type, either neutral small mols. or an ionic liquid (organic salt), and of the difference of the glass transition temperatures of the solvent and polymer. In contrast, the exponent became smaller (v ≈ 1.3) for the solutions in an oligomeric solvent. These results are discussed within the frame of the two-length scaling theory that considers changes of ξ and a with ϕ. Raman study of intramolecular frequency noncoincidence effect in dialkyl benzenedicarboxylates was written by Kim, Yoo Joong;Chang, Hai-Chou;Sullivan, Vivian S.;Jonas, Jiri. And the article was included in Journal of Chemical Physics in 1999.SDS of cas: 5444-75-7 The following contents are mentioned in the article:

Raman noncoincidence effects (NCE) of the C:O stretching band of dialkyl esters of phthalic, isophthalic, and terephthalic acids were measured as a function of concentration in MeCN and dioxane solutions By quenching the intermol. vibrational interactions between the C:O groups of neighboring mols. by dilution, the NCE arising from the coupling between 2 C:O stretching vibrations in a single diester mol. was observed for the 1st time. The intramol. NCE values for these mols. were neg. and dependent on the relative orientation and distance between the 2 C:O groups in the mol. Similarly as for most intermol. NCE, the intramol. NCE is explained by the transition-dipole coupling mechanism. The presence of a single dipolar coupling pair allows one to express the intramol. NCE values by a simple anal. equation with a few mol. parameters including those for the arrangement of the 2 C:O groups. The observed intramol. NCE values are well predicted, with a limitation of large dipolar distance, by the equation with the geometric parameters obtained from the ab initio optimized structures. In fact, the NCEs provided information about detailed conformational structure of the benzenedicarboxylates in dilute solutions Since the intramol. NCE value indeed corresponds to a frequency difference between the in-phase and out-of-phase C:O stretching normal modes of a mol., suggesting that the vibrational coupling between the 2 C:O internal coordinates in these mols. is mainly due to the transition dipolar interaction. Carbon-13 NMR Study of the Effect of Confinement on the Molecular Dynamics of 2-Ethylhexyl Benzoate was written by Sullivan, Vivian S.;Kim, Yoo Joong;Xu, Shu;Jonas, Jiri;Korb, J.-P.. And the article was included in Langmuir in 1999.Application of 5444-75-7 The following contents are mentioned in the article:

Spin-lattice relaxation times of individual carbons in 2-ethylhexyl benzoate (EHB) in bulk and confined to porous silica glasses of pore radii of 33, 52, and 102 Å were measured as a function of temperature from +40 to -51 °C. The two-state fast exchange model was successfully applied, in the wide temperature range including beyond the motional narrowing regime, to determine the spin-lattice relaxation times of the mols. in the surface layer (T1S) as a function of temperature The Cole-Davidson distribution model was used to analyze the relaxation data for both the bulk (T1B) and surface layer (T1S) of the confined liquid The line broadening of confined EHB at lower temperatures below -21 °C inherently limited the temperature range over which T1S could be estimated and prevented the quant. anal. of T1S by the model. Through the phenomenol. comparison of T1S with T1B in terms of the parameters of the Cole-Davidson model, it was found that the motional behavior of the Ph ring part of the EHB mol. was significantly affected by the surface interaction and the effect is smaller for the flexible alkyl chain. Small temperature dependence of the relaxation rate of T1S at motional narrowing regime showed a characteristic feature of liquid diffusing on a two-dimensional surface. In addition, the results of the quant. anal. of T1B were compared with a previous experiment performed as a function of pressure. New plasticizer and coalescent for graphic arts applications was written by Arendt, William D.;Brewer, Rebecca D.;McBride, Emily L.. And the article was included in Proceedings of the International Waterborne, High-Solids, and Powder Coatings Symposium in 2012.COA of Formula: C15H22O2 The following contents are mentioned in the article:

Waterborne overprint varnish (OPV) has a significant role in the graphic arts industry. Some of the polymers used in this coatings industry segment are non-film formers at room temperature A plasticizer and/or a coalescent is required to help form a film properly to ensure full development of performance properties with these hard polymers. Glycol ethers, phthalates esters (such as Bu benzyl phthalate) and benzoate esters have been employed as plasticizers/coalescents for OPVs as well as ink. A new dibenzoate triblend plasticizer platform has been recently introduced for use in architectural coatings as a low VOC plasticizer/coalescent. Based on its broad range of compatibilities with polymers utilized in the coatings industry (for example, in vinyl acrylic, acrylic and styrene acrylic types), one of the triblend plasticizers, X-20, was evaluated initially in polymer dispersion/coalescent binary blends, a waterborne OPV and an ink formulation. In addition to the triblend, an entirely new monobenzoate plasticizer/coalescent will be introduced to the industry as an effective lower VOC alternative. The polymer selected for this evaluation is an industry standard hard styrene acrylic type utilized in simple starting formulations. This basic OPV evaluation includes the effect of the plasticizer/coalescent on min. film formation temperature, adhesion to different substrates, rub resistance, alkali and water resistance, viscosity response of the polymer dispersion, gloss, and other supporting data. New low odor benzoate coalescent for latex paint was written by Arendt, William D.. And the article was included in Proceedings of the International Waterborne, High-Solids, and Powder Coatings Symposium in 2000.Computed Properties of C15H22O2 The following contents are mentioned in the article:

Coalescents used in latex paint are known to contribute to VOC (volatile organic compounds) content, and can also contribute to the odor of a recently dried coating. With the more stringent environmental regulations that formulators must accommodate, there is a need in the industry for a highly efficient, low odor and VOC coalescent. Recently, 2-ethylhexyl benzoate, a new benzoate ester that is low in odor and lower in VOC than the com. coalescent 2,2,4-trimethyl-1,3-pentanediol monoisobutyrate (abbreviated TMB), was evaluated as a latex paint coalescent. The 2-ethylhexyl benzoate was evaluated for function in the following types of latex paints: contractor and high quality interior flats, an interior semigloss, an interior gloss, and exterior flat paints. The 2-ethylhexyl benzoate was compared to TMB in paint formulations at equal and low (-25% by weight) levels of the control coalescent. The evaluation specifically focused on the effect of coalescent on tests relating to coalescent function such as low temperature film formation and scrub resistance. The results indicated that the 2-ethylhexyl benzoate performed as well, or better than TMB coalescent, and was more efficient. In addition to being an effective and efficient coalescent, the 2-ethylhexyl benzoate is low in odor (neat and in room after paint application), and has a lower VOC that the TMB. The new coalescent offers the latex paint formulator an efficient raw material for the development of low odor and lower VOC latex paint. Transport properties of fluids using new rough hard-sphere and molecular dynamics simulation was written by Farhadi, Mitra;Fakhraee, Sara;Akbari, Falamarz. And the article was included in Journal of Molecular Liquids in 2019.Application of 5444-75-7 The following contents are mentioned in the article:

We have studied transport properties, as well as the self-diffusion, viscosity and thermal conductivity of fluids by using new semi-theor. model based on the rough hard-sphere (RHS) theory. In the present study, the proposed RHS is employed to model the transport properties of CH4, CCl4, C6H6, CHCl3, H2O, R134a, 2-EHB, PE and PS for temperatures ranging from 110 to 530 K and at pressures up to 1000 MPa. Parameters appeared in the new RHS model are taken from previously developed perturbed hard-trimer chain (PHTC) equation of state. From 174 exptl. data points examined, the average absolute relative deviation AARD of predicted viscosities for CH4, H2O and R134a was found to be 6.59%. In the case of self-diffusion, the new RHS-based model correlated and predicted 139 exptl. data points with AARD equal to 4.06%. The proposed RHS-based model has also been extended to predicted 228 exptl. data points of thermal conductivity for CH4, H2O and R134a with AARD equal to 4.54%. In addition, mol. dynamics (MD) calculations were performed with the GROMACS simulation package and to investigate the thermophys. properties of fluids. The MD approach enabled us to calculate the d., viscosity, self-diffusion and thermal conductivity of CH4 and C6H6. Finally, MD is applied to calculate d. of binary water-alc. mixtures including water-methanol and water-ethanol. Comparison of aroma components in eleven medium- and late-maturing Yantai apple cultivars by multivariate statistical analysis was written by Sun, Cheng-feng;Zhu, Liang;Zhou, Nan;Yang, Jian-rong;Li, Yan-shen;Jiang, Zhong-wu. And the article was included in Xiandai Shipin Keji in 2015.HPLC of Formula: 5444-75-7 The following contents are mentioned in the article:

To investigate the differences in the major aroma components between medium- and late-maturing Yantai apple cultivars, headspace solid phase microextraction (HS-SPME) combined with gas chromatog. mass spectrometry (GC-MS) was employed. The apple cultivars and their aroma components were analyzed using principal component anal. (PCA) and cluster anal. (CA). The results showed that 59 aroma compounds were identified from 11 apple cultivars, and 21 of these were common to all apple cultivars. Among the common aroma components, acetate esters, butyrate esters, hexanoate esters, hexanal (including 2-hexenal), and some higher alcs. showed higher concentrations The PCA results indicated that the comprehensive scores of Yang Guang and Dan Xia apples were the highest, while that of the Extremely Precocious Fuji apple was the lowest. The comprehensive score ranking reflected the differences of the major aroma components between the apple cultivars. The CA results showed that 11 apple cultivars could be classified into four clusters. Yantai Fuji 3, Dou Nan, Gan Hong, Extremely Precocious Fuji, Pinova, Yantai Fuji 1, and Best Short Fuji were classified into a cluster; Dan Xia and Yang Guang were classified into a cluster; and Liang Xiang and Hua Shuai were classified into two clusters. Through an effective combination of PCA and CA, the aroma characteristics of four apple cultivars (Dan Xia, Yang Guang, Liang Xiang, and Hua Shuai) were more prominent, providing a basis for parent selection in future apple breeding. Coalescent formulation studies: Efficiency and partition rates was written by Arendt, William D.;Strepka, Arron M.;Gruszecki, Kristy. And the article was included in Proceedings of the International Waterborne, High-Solids, and Powder Coatings Symposium in 2001.Product Details of 5444-75-7 The following contents are mentioned in the article:

2-Ethylhexyl benzoate (2EHB) was recently introduced to the coatings industry as a low odor, low volatility coalescent. The original architectural paint data indicated that 2EHB is an effective coalescent for latex paint, and some of the data indicated that 2EHB is more efficient than the 2,2,4-tri-Me, 1-3-pentanediol monoisobutyrate (TMB). This initial efficiency data suggested the need to better define the apparent efficiency of 2EHB, factors affecting efficiency and its measurement. It was decided to measure efficiency performance in paint as opposed to measurements in neat emulsion coalescent blends. The primary yardstick tests chosen were low temperature coalescence (by porosity determinations and visual assessment), scrub resistance (room temperature and low temperature dry), and low temperature touch up. The efficiency data developed confirms that overall 2EHB is about 25% more efficient than TMB. However, differences in formulations sometimes hide these efficiencies. For example, it was difficult measure efficiency in high PVC flats. Also, in some high Tg polymers, the partition rate of 2EHB was slower than TMB. This fact can mask efficiency. The chem. nature of 2EHB is different from the TMB and this difference, in a few instances, may require different formulation or processing strategies. Understanding of performance differences is necessary to fully exploit 2EHB’s potential as an efficient latex paint coalescent. Guidelines on maximizing the efficiency of 2EHB as a coalescent will be presented. Synthesis and characterization of AMO LDH-derived mixed oxides with various Mg/Al ratios as acid-basic catalysts for esterification of benzoic acid with 2-ethylhexanol was written by Kuljiraseth, J.;Wangriya, A.;Malones, J. M. C.;Klysubun, W.;Jitkarnka, S.. And the article was included in Applied Catalysis, B: Environmental in 2019.Safety of 2-Ethylhexyl benzoate The following contents are mentioned in the article:

Proven to possess distinguishable phys. and acid-base properties superior to conventional LDHs, aqueous miscible organic solvent-layered double hydroxides (AMO-LDHs) were thus synthesized and used as precursors to prepare the Mg/Al mixed oxide catalysts in this work. The AMO-LDH based oxide catalysts with various ratios of Mg/Al were studied for the chem. and phys. properties and the activity on esterification of benzoic acid with 2-ethylhexanol. The catalysts were characterized using BET, XRD, TGA, and XPS. Moreover, the acid-base properties were studied. As a result, the Mg/Al mixed oxides after calcination at 500 °C still had the clay structure, and were found to possess both acid and base sites. As the Mg/Al ratio increased, the total d. of acid and basic sites decreased. Moreover, the acid-basic strength depended on their phase compositions and coordination number The activity of calcined LDHs catalysts was tested for the esterification of benzoic acid with 2-ethylhexanol, aimed at producing 2-ethylhexyl benzoate as the desired chem. The products were analyzed using GC-MS/TOF. In summary, the conversion of benzoic acid was enhanced significantly using the Mg-Al mixed oxides as the catalysts, owing to the acid-base sites (both Mg2+-O2- and Al3+-O2- pairs) of the catalysts. The catalyst with the Mg/Al ratio of 4:1 can convert 66% benzoic acid to 2-ethylhexyl benzoate. Moreover, the other products were composed of 2-ethylhexanal, 3-heptanone, and 3-heptanol because of acid-base pairs. Detection of prohibited treatment products on racing tires using headspace solid phase microextraction (SPME) and gas chromatography/mass spectrometry (GC/MS) was written by Kranz, W. D.;Carroll, C. J.;Goodpaster, J. V.. And the article was included in Analytical Methods in 2016.Electric Literature of C15H22O2 The following contents are mentioned in the article:

A variety of com. tire treatments are available that purport to help automobile tires better cling to the surface of a road or racetrack, raising concerns in the professional racing community that such products might be used to illicitly boost performance in competitive events. These tire treatments are reputed to cut lap times and improve handling and maneuverability. In some cases, the manufacturers even boast that their products are “undetectable” (i.e., impervious to the scrutiny of laboratory testing). In this study, a number of banned tire treatment products were evaluated principally by gas chromatog.-mass spectrometry (GC-MS) using solid phase microextraction (SPME) as a pre-concentration technique. The chems. off-gassed by each product were determined and grouped into two broad categories: ‘plasticizer-based’ tire treatment products and ‘hydrocarbon-based’ tire treatment products. This information was then applied to the anal. of genuine tire samples provided by the United States Auto Club (USAC), a professional racing association Over the course of one year, 10 out of the 71 questioned samples tested pos. for a prohibited treatment product. The manufacturers’ claims regarding their products’ invisibility to lab tests were largely proven to be unfounded: both the products themselves and the tires treated with them can be identified by a number of characteristic volatile compounds These included known plasticizers such as pentanedioic acid di-Et ester, plasticizer-related compounds such as 2-ethyl-1-hexanol, and dearomatized distillates.
